1 And when the queen of Sheba heard of the fame of Solomon concerning the name of the LORD, she came to prove him with hard questions.1 Now the queen of Sheba, hearing great things of Solomon, came to put his wisdom to the test with hard questions.1 스바 여왕이 여호와의 이름으로 말미암은 솔로몬의 명예를 듣고 와서 어려운 문제로 저를 시험코자 하여
2 And she came to Jerusalem with a very great train, with camels that bare spices, and very much gold, and precious stones: and when she was come to Solomon, she communed with him of all that was in her heart.2 And she came to Jerusalem with a very great train, with camels weighted down with spices, and stores of gold and jewels: and when she came to Solomon she had talk with him of everything in her mind.2 예루살렘에 이르니 수원이 심히 많고 향품과 심히 많은 금과 보석을 약대에 실었더라 저가 솔로몬에게 나아와 자기 마음에 있는 것을 다 말하매
3 And Solomon told her all her questions: there was not any thing hid from the king, which he told her not.3 And Solomon gave her answers to all her questions; there was no secret which the king did not make clear to her.3 솔로몬이 그 묻는 말을 다 대답하였으니 왕이 은미하여 대답지 못한 것이 없었더라
4 And when the queen of Sheba had seen all Solomon's wisdom, and the house that he had built,4 And when the queen of Sheba had seen all the wisdom of Solomon, and the house which he had made,4 스바 여왕이 솔로몬의 모든 지혜와 그 건축한 궁과
5 And the meat of his table, and the sitting of his servants, and the attendance of his ministers, and their apparel, and his cupbearers, and his ascent by which he went up unto the house of the LORD; there was no more spirit in her.5 And the food at his table, and all his servants seated there, and those who were waiting on him in their places, and their robes, and his wine-servants, and the burned offerings which he made in the house of the Lord, there was no more spirit in her.5 그 상의 식물과 그 신복들의 좌석과 그 신하들의 시립한 것과 그들의 공복과 술관원들과 여호와의 전에 올라가는 층계를 보고 정신이 현황하여
6 And she said to the king, It was a true report that I heard in mine own land of thy acts and of thy wisdom.6 And she said to the king, The account which was given to me in my country of your acts and your wisdom was true.6 왕께 고하되 내가 내 나라에서 당신의 행위와 당신의 지혜에 대하여 들은 소문이 진실하도다
7 Howbeit I believed not the words, until I came, and mine eyes had seen it: and, behold, the half was not told me: thy wisdom and prosperity exceedeth the fame which I heard.7 But I had no faith in what was said about you, till I came and saw for myself; and now I see that it was not half the story; your wisdom and your wealth are much greater than they said.7 내가 그 말들을 믿지 아니하였더니 이제 와서 목도한즉 내게 말한 것은 절반도 못되니 당신의 지혜와 복이 나의 들은 소문에 지나도다
8 Happy are thy men, happy are these thy servants, which stand continually before thee, and that hear thy wisdom.8 Happy are your wives, happy are these your servants whose place is ever before you, hearing your words of wisdom.8 복되도다 당신의 사람들이여 복되도다 당신의 이 신복들이여 항상 당신의 앞에 서서 당신의 지혜를 들음이로다
9 Blessed be the LORD thy God, which delighted in thee, to set thee on the throne of Israel: because the LORD loved Israel for ever, therefore made he thee king, to do judgment and justice.9 May the Lord your God be praised, whose pleasure it was to put you on the seat of the kingdom of Israel; because the Lord's love for Israel is eternal, he has made you king, to be their judge in righteousness.9 당신의 하나님 여호와를 송축할찌로다 여호와께서 당신을 기뻐하사 이스라엘 위에 올리셨고 여호와께서 영영히 이스라엘을 사랑하시므로 당신을 세워 왕을 삼아 공과 의를 행하게 하셨도다 하고
10 And she gave the king an hundred and twenty talents of gold, and of spices very great store, and precious stones: there came no more such abundance of spices as these which the queen of Sheba gave to king Solomon.10 And she gave the king a hundred and twenty talents of gold, and a great store of spices and jewels: never again was such a wealth of spices seen as that which the queen of Sheba gave King Solomon.10 이에 저가 금 일백 이십 달란트와 심히 많은 향품과 보석을 왕께 드렸으니 스바 여왕이 솔로몬왕께 드린 것처럼 많은 향품이 다시 오지 아니하였더라
11 And the navy also of Hiram, that brought gold from Ophir, brought in from Ophir great plenty of almug trees, and precious stones.11 And the sea-force of Hiram, in addition to gold from Ophir, came back with much sandal-wood and jewels.11 [오빌에서부터 금을 실어온 히람의 배들이 오빌에서 많은 백단목과 보석을 운반하여 오매
12 And the king made of the almug trees pillars for the house of the LORD, and for the king's house, harps also and psalteries for singers: there came no such almug trees, nor were seen unto this day.12 And from the sandal-wood the king made pillars for the house of the Lord, and for the king's house, and instruments of music for the makers of melody: never has such sandal-wood been seen to this day.12 왕이 백단목으로 여호와의 전과 왕궁의 난간을 만들고 또 노래하는 자를 위하여 수금과 비파를 만들었으니 이같은 백단목은 전에도 온 일이 없었고 오늘까지도 보지 못하였더라]

14 Now the weight of gold that came to Solomon in one year was six hundred threescore and six talents of gold,14 Now the weight of gold which came to Solomon in one year was six hundred and sixty-six talents;14 솔로몬의 세입금의 중수가 육백 륙십 륙 금 달란트요
15 Beside that he had of the merchantmen , and of the traffic of the spice merchants, and of all the kings of Arabia, and of the governors of the country.15 In addition to what came to him from the business of the traders, and from all the kings of the Arabians, and from the rulers of the country.15 그 외에 또 상고와 무역하는 객상과 아라비아 왕들과 나라의 방백들에게서도 가져온지라
16 And king Solomon made two hundred targets of beaten gold: six hundred shekels of gold went to one target.16 And Solomon made two hundred body-covers of hammered gold, every one having six hundred shekels of gold in it.16 솔로몬왕이 쳐서 늘인 금으로 큰 방패 이백을 만들었으니 매 방패에 든 금이 육백 세겔이며
17 And he made three hundred shields of beaten gold; three pound of gold went to one shield: and the king put them in the house of the forest of Lebanon.17 And he made three hundred smaller body-covers of hammered gold, with three pounds of gold in every cover: and the king put them in the house of the Woods of Lebanon.17 또 쳐서 늘인 금으로 작은 방패 삼백을 만들었으니 매 방패에 든 금이 삼 마네라 왕이 이것들을 레바논 나무 궁에 두었더라
18 Moreover the king made a great throne of ivory, and overlaid it with the best gold.18 Then the king made a great ivory seat, plated with the best gold.18 왕이 또 상아로 큰 보좌를 만들고 정금으로 입혔으니
19 The throne had six steps, and the top of the throne was round behind: and there were stays on either side on the place of the seat, and two lions stood beside the stays.19 There were six steps going up to it, and the top of it was round at the back, there were arms on the two sides of the seat, and two lions by the side of the arms;19 그 보좌에는 여섯 층계가 있고 보좌 뒤에 둥근 머리가 있고 앉는 자리 양편에는 팔걸이가 있고 팔걸이 곁에는 사자가 하나씩 섰으며
20 And twelve lions stood there on the one side and on the other upon the six steps: there was not the like made in any kingdom.20 And twelve lions were placed on the one side and on the other side on the six steps: there was nothing like it in any kingdom.20 또 열 두 사자가 있어 그 여섯 층계 좌우편에 섰으니 아무 나라에도 이같이 만든 것이 없었더라
21 And all king Solomon's drinking vessels were of gold, and all the vessels of the house of the forest of Lebanon were of pure gold; none were of silver: it was nothing accounted of in the days of Solomon.21 And all King Solomon's drinking-vessels were of gold, and all the vessels of the house of the Woods of Lebanon were of the best gold; not one was of silver, for no one gave a thought to silver in the days of King Solomon.21 솔로몬왕의 마시는 그릇은 다 금이요 레바논 나무 궁의 그릇들도 다 정금이라 은 기물이 없으니 솔로몬의 시대에 은을 귀히 여기지 아니함은
22 For the king had at sea a navy of Tharshish with the navy of Hiram: once in three years came the navy of Tharshish, bringing gold, and silver, ivory, and apes, and peacocks.22 For the king had Tarshish-ships at sea with the ships of Hiram; once every three years the Tarshish-ships came with gold and silver and ivory and monkeys and peacocks.22 왕이 바다에 다시스 배들을 두어 히람의 배와 함께 있게 하고 그 다시스 배로 삼년에 일차씩 금과 은과 상아와 잔나비와 공작을 실어 왔음이더라
23 So king Solomon exceeded all the kings of the earth for riches and for wisdom.23 And King Solomon was greater than all the kings of the earth in wealth and in wisdom.23 솔로몬왕의 재산과 지혜가 천하 열왕보다 큰지라
24 And all the earth sought to Solomon, to hear his wisdom, which God had put in his heart.24 And from all over the earth they came to see Solomon and to give ear to his wisdom, which God had put in his heart.24 천하가 다 하나님께서 솔로몬의 마음에 주신 지혜를 들으며 그 얼굴을 보기 원하여
25 And they brought every man his present, vessels of silver, and vessels of gold, and garments, and armour, and spices, horses, and mules, a rate year by year.25 And everyone took with him an offering, vessels of silver and vessels of gold, and robes, and coats of metal, and spices, and horses, and beasts of transport, regularly year by year.25 각기 예물을 가지고 왔으니 곧 은 그릇과 금 그릇과 의복과 갑옷과 향품과 말과 노새라 해마다 정한 수가 있었더라
26 And Solomon gathered together chariots and horsemen: and he had a thousand and four hundred chariots, and twelve thousand horsemen, whom he bestowed in the cities for chariots, and with the king at Jerusalem.26 And Solomon got together war-carriages and horsemen; he had one thousand, four hundred carriages and twelve thousand horsemen, whom he kept, some in the carriage-towns and some with the king at Jerusalem.26 솔로몬이 병거와 마병을 모으매 병거가 일천 사백이요 마병이 일만 이천이라 병거성에도 두고 예루살렘 왕에게도 두었으며
27 And the king made silver to be in Jerusalem as stones, and cedars made he to be as the sycamore trees that are in the vale, for abundance.27 And the king made silver as common as stones in Jerusalem and cedars like the sycamore-trees of the lowlands in number.27 왕이 예루살렘에서 은을 돌 같이 흔하게 하고 백향목을 평지의 뽕나무 같이 많게 하였더라
28 And Solomon had horses brought out of Egypt, and linen yarn: the king's merchants received the linen yarn at a price.28 And Solomon's horses came from Egypt and from Kue; the king's traders got them at a price from Kue.28 솔로몬의 말들은 애굽에서 내어왔으니 왕의 상고들이 떼로 정가하여 산 것이며
29 And a chariot came up and went out of Egypt for six hundred shekels of silver, and an horse for an hundred and fifty: and so for all the kings of the Hittites, and for the kings of Syria, did they bring them out by their means.29 A war-carriage might be got from Egypt for six hundred shekels of silver, and a horse for a hundred and fifty; they got them at the same rate for all the kings of the Hittites and the kings of Aram.29 애굽에서 내어올린 병거는 하나에 은 육백 세겔이요 말은 일백 오십 세겔이라 이와 같이 헷 사람의 모든 왕과 아람 왕들을 위하여도 그 손으로 내어왔더라
